Mustang Mowing is the company I started using my beloved convertible mustang that I never planned on towing a trailer with. I started this business because I wanted to go to the next level of operating and leave the confinement of my neighborhood to go out and serve the public. But to do this I needed the equipment to handle multiple lawns a day and transport said equipment around my city, and in a nutshell that’s how the company was born.

I became started started in this business by just helping my neighbor cut his grass in the summer. It evolved into me starting with some some landscaping work, and getting the idea to start cutting lawns in my neighborhood. I am motivated and an active communicator so you will always know when I will be arriving, what services will be done, and how much I will charge. I also have professional, reliable equipment and can be depended on to leave your lawn looking better than your neighbor’s! I service all neighborhoods in the north Wilmington area in neighborhoods such as Holly Oak, Fairfax, Talleyville, Alapocas, Arden, Bellefonte, Edgemoor, etc. For additional landscaping services I offer mulch, leaf cleanup, weeding, small pruning or trimming, and small tree or shrub removal. Outside of landscaping I am a student at Salesianum School and enjoy running and being outside in my free time.

I have been in business servicing my neighborhood since last spring and this year I plan to greatly expand my business and take my skills all over the city. I got started because I enjoyed mowing lawns for my neighbors and got a passion for making the properties look better. From there I began to acquire all the proper equipment to become more professional and got started as a way of keeping busy in the summers.

My work is set apart from others because I use a wide zero turn mower to lay diagonal or straight stripes that are complemented by clean and crisp edges around all of the customer’s sidewalk, garden beds, and driveway. At the very end when everything is stored away I take the time to use my blower one last time and clear off the customer’s driveway and front porch to ensure no grass clippings are left behind.

I would tell a customer looking to hire a provider like myself, not to overlook my company because of my age or due to this 2020 season being my first official year in business. I ran a smaller scale landscaping service last year within my neighborhood and serviced 3 weekly customers throughout the whole season. I am now up for the challenge of taking on more business and putting in the work to make all of my customer’s lawns look fantastic!

I enjoy this industry because it gives me the ability to work on my schedule, while spending time outside and staying active. It also gives me the ability to help people improve the way their property looks, which gives me a feeling of satisfaction.
